How they compare
Mongolia currently reports 37.2% against 34.9% in Moldova, a difference of 2.3%.
That makes Mongolia's figure about 1.1 times Moldova's.
Across all 10 years both countries report, Mongolia has been ahead every year.
Moldova ranks 54th and Mongolia ranks 53rd of 120 countries.
Mongolia has averaged higher in every one of the 4 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Moldova | Mongolia |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1990s | 89.8% | 97.4% | 7.7% | Mongolia |
| 2000s | 65.7% | 75.6% | 9.9% | Mongolia |
| 2010s | 37.9% | 54.6% | 16.7% | Mongolia |
| 2020s | 36.0% | 37.2% | 1.2% | Mongolia |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
